Gov Ayade Appoints Five Permanent Secretaries
Cross River State Gov, Ben Ayade has appointed five Permanent Secretaries into the state public service.

This is coming 25 days to the end of his administration.
Their elevation from the position of directors to permanent secretaries was announced in a statement on Thursday by the Head of Service, Timothy Akwaji.

According to him, “His Excellency, the Governor of Cross River State, Sen. Prof Ben Ayade, has approved the elevation of the underlisted directors to the rank of permanent secretary in the state public service.”
They are Ushie Esther Peter, Irek Matthew Esikpe, Atim Okokon Ekpenyong, Emmanuel Egban and Abu Ikwo Eyo.

Akwaji said their appointments take effect from April 27, 2023.
Recall that some days back, civil Servants in Cross River said the lifting of the embargo placed on the promotion of civil servants by Gov. Ben Ayade came late.
They, therefore, said they would not applaud his administration for the feat, alleging that it was meant to burden the incoming administration.

A cross-section of the workers disclosed this in separate interviews with the newsmen on Monday in Calabar.
They said the governor was only trying to increase the wage bill of the incoming administration.
